  1. Choose the Right Part-Time Job

The first step in maximizing your earnings from a part-time job is to select the right job. Consider your skills, interests, and availability. Look for positions that align with your strengths and preferences, as you’ll be more likely to excel and enjoy your work. Additionally, explore job opportunities in high-demand sectors, such as customer service, healthcare, and e-commerce, where part-time positions are frequently available.

  1. Optimize Your Work Schedule

Once you’ve secured a part-time job, it’s crucial to optimize your work schedule to make the most money. Communicate with your employer about your availability and seek shifts that best align with your goals. Try to avoid overlapping shifts if you have multiple part-time jobs, as this can lead to burnout and reduced efficiency.

  1. Enhance Your Skills

Investing time and effort in enhancing your skills can significantly increase your earning potential. Consider taking online courses or workshops related to your job or industry. Many platforms offer free or affordable options for skill development. Acquiring new skills or improving existing ones can lead to promotions, pay raises, and better job opportunities.

  1. Negotiate Your Pay

Don’t be afraid to negotiate your pay, even in a part-time position. Research industry standards and local wage rates for similar roles and use this information to support your negotiation. Employers often value employees who advocate for themselves, and negotiating for a higher wage can significantly impact your earnings.

  1. Pursue Freelance or Gig Work

If your part-time job doesn’t provide the financial stability you need, consider pursuing freelance or gig work in addition to your primary employment. Freelancing platforms like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er offer a wide range of opportunities in various fields, from writing and graphic design to web development and consulting. These gigs can be done on a flexible schedule, allowing you to maximize your income.

  1. Create a Budget

To effectively manage your earnings from your part-time job, create a budget that outlines your income, expenses, and savings goals. Allocate a portion of your income to essential expenses such as rent, utilities, groceries, and transportation. Set aside another portion for savings and investments, which can help you grow your wealth over time.

  1. Explore Passive Income Streams

While working a part-time job, consider exploring passive income streams that can generate money even when you’re not actively working. Examples include investing in stocks, bonds, or real estate, creating an online course or eBook, or starting a blog or YouTube channel that generates advertising revenue.

  1. Use Money-Saving Strategies

Maximizing your earnings also involves minimizing unnecessary expenses. Look for ways to save money on everyday expenses like groceries, dining out, and entertainment. Utilize coupons, cashback apps, and loyalty programs to get the most value for your money. The more you save, the more you can allocate to your financial goals.

  1. Side Hustles and Part-Time Business Ventures

In addition to your part-time job, consider starting a side hustle or small business venture that aligns with your skills and interests. Side hustles like tutoring, pet sitting, or selling handmade crafts can generate extra income and potentially grow into full-time businesses. These ventures allow you to be your own boss and have control over your earnings.

  1. Network and Seek Opportunities

Networking can play a crucial role in finding higher-paying part-time job opportunities. Attend industry events, join professional associations, and connect with professionals in your field on social media platforms like LinkedIn. Building a strong network can lead to job referrals, freelance opportunities, and mentorship.

  1. Monitor and Adjust

Regularly monitor your financial progress and be prepared to make adjustments to your strategies. If you find that your current part-time job is not meeting your financial goals, don’t hesitate to explore other opportunities or negotiate for better terms. Flexibility and adaptability are key to making the most of your part-time job.
